Relaxation and pumping of quantum oscillator nonresonantly coupled with the other oscillator [PDF]
The paper shows mechanisms of both the pumping and energy decay of an "isolated" oscillator. The oscillator is only non-resonantly coupled with the adjacent oscillator which resonantly interacts with the thermal bath environment. Under these conditions the "isolated" oscillator begins interacting with the thermal bath environment of the adjacent ...

Chiral Engineered Biomaterials: New Frontiers in Cellular Fate Regulation for Regenerative Medicine
Chiral engineered biomaterials can selectively influence cell behaviors in regenerative medicine. This review covers chiral engineered biomaterials in terms of their fabrication methods, cellular response mechanisms, and applications in directing stem cell differentiation and tissue function.

The main frequencies of solar core natural oscillations [PDF]
The oscillations of a spherical body consisting of hot electron-nuclear plasma are considered. It is shown that there are two basic modes of oscillations. The estimation of the main frequencies of the solar core oscillation gives a satisfactory fit of the calculated spectrum and the measurement data.
